A wafer is a material made of silicon, germanium or other semiconductor material used in the creation of integrated circuits (ICs) which are the building blocks of present day electronics. Spin coating is a process which deposits thin films of material, generally a photoresist on to a single wafer. The photoresist is applied to the center of wafer. The wafer is then rotated at high speed, resulting in centrifugal force which uniformly spreads the photoresist over the entire wafer. The thickness of the film is inversely proportional to the speed of wafer rotation. The process is done by a machine know as spin coater or spin processor or spinner.
